First take the cap out of your car or whoever has one. Like stated above it is not his head unit that makes it louder, just set your amp's gain setting to match your pre-out voltage (which will give you the same results as stated above). The car makes the sound seem different in two different vehicles with the same equipment, plus his stock electrical is probably better then yours which will provide more power. So a line driver wont do it, read all these post above carefully and you will understand no line driver. -

I would plan the system out smarter than that so you wont be waisting money in the long run. Such as buy one sub now at D1 version so when you buy the other one you will already have the right voice coil's on them. Now if you want the Nightshades v2, then I would just start saving up for an amp to each or one single amp however you plan on doing it so you can get the amps out the way while waiting on the subwoofers. This will also allow you to get you car ready for the install such as wiring, electrical and such.
